Downtown Weslaco homes and older plumbing runs
Many of the mid-century houses along and near Business 83 and Texas Boulevard still carry their original supply lines and drain connections into the water heater closet. When a tank in one of these homes finally goes out, the fitting behind it has usually aged right along with it, so an installer needs to check that connection before setting a new unit rather than assuming a direct swap will work.
